Abstract
ObjectiveTo observe the effects of creatine phosphate sodium on heart function and B-type natriuretic peptide in patients combination with ischemic cardiomyopathy and intractable heart failure.
Methods70 cases of coronary heart disease combined with ischemic cardiomyopathy and intractable heart failure were randomly(with the random number table)divided into the control group(n= 33)and the creatine phosphate sodium treatment group(n= 37). The control group treated with conventional therapy(digitalis,diuretics,vasodilator,ACEI,et al)ten days;the treatment group with creatine phosphate sodium treatment on the basis of conventional therapy.The symptom,sign of the heart failure patients of the two groups before and after treatment were observed.NYHA cardiac functional grading were estimated.Echocardiography was used to detect left ventricular end-systolic diameter(LVESD),left ventricular end diastolic diameter(LVEDD)and left ventricular ejection fraction(LVEF); amino terminal pro brain natriuretic peptide(NT-proBNP)tested by laboratory of the two groups.Drug treatment for 10 days,the changes of the indicators before and after treatment were observed.
ResultsAfter treatment,compared with the control group[(50.63±4.67)mm,(61.30±4.58)mm].LVESD,LVEDD of the creatine phosphate sodium treatment[(47.16±4.30)mm,(57.92±4.30)mm]significantly decreased(t= 5.73,4.96,all P<0.01),LVEF[(40.57±4.51)%,(37.63±4.53)%]increased significantly(t= 5.53,P< 0.01).After ten days of treatment levels of NT-proBNP decreased in both two groups[(1 659.±248.18)pg/mL,1 899.3 ±205.45]than before treatment[2 043.46±217.04,(2 105.46±239.09)pg/mL](t= 3.23,3.64,all P< 0.05),and the decrease degree of the creatine phosphate sodium treatment group was more obvious than those of the control group(t= 4.11,P<0.05).
ConclusionCreatine phosphate sodium can improve the cardiac function and left ventricular ejection fraction of ischemic cardiomyopathy and intractable heart failurepatients,enhance the clinical symptoms of patients.
